What is the valve body on a transmission?
The valve body acts as the control center of the automatic transmission. When a shift is needed, valves open and close to direct transmission fluid to the appropriate area to make the gear change occur. Transmission fluid, unlike motor oil, is more than just a lubricating fluid; it’s a hydraulic fluid.

What should I do if my flush valve is not working?
Check to make sure that the water rises to the water mark. The water level should usually line up with the water mark on the inside of the toilet bowl. If water does not rise to the right level in the toilet, adjust the filler valve. You can adjust the filler valve dramatically by moving the entire valve up or down.

How much does it cost to replace transmission valve body?
The cost of replacing a bad transmission valve body will depend on the make and model of your vehicle. However, it is one of the more expensive car part replacements that you will need to make. On average, a transmission valve body piece will cost you anywhere from $200 to $500. Then you must consider the labor costs which will be quite extensive.

What’s the best way to remove a flush valve?
Locate the thick, conical rubber gasket and remove it. Underneath the gasket you’ll see a large plastic nut. Loosen and remove the plastic nut to remove the flush valve. Start to loosen the nut by turning it counterclockwise with your pliers. The flush valve will come right off.

How to replace a flush valve on an American Standard?
STEP 1: To begin, turn off the water supply. Then, drain the tank by holding down the handle or lifting the valve chain inside the tank. STEP 2: Depress the trip lever and remove the clevis pin from the trip lever rod. Then, detach the trip lever rod from the flush valve.
